Congratulations to Edward Wan for his Incredible Math Accolades!

Congratulations to Edward Wan (‘21) who won the USA Math Olympiad as one of the top 12 winners for the second year in a row. Mr. Luis Valentin joined him in Washington DC as he accepted his award.

In addition, Edward made the 2019 USA IMO (International Math Olympiad) Team as one of the top 6 high school math students in the nation. He is going to Bath, UK to compete in the 2019 IMO, representing USA. We are extremely proud of Edward’s hard work and dedication to mathematics.

Saint John’s School

Saint John’s School is a non-profit, college preparatory, nonsectarian, coeducational day school founded in 1915. The school, located in a residential area of Condado, in San Juan, Puerto Rico, has an enrollment of over 800 students from pre pre-kinder to grade twelve. Instruction is mostly in English with the exception of language courses.
